Word | Foreman |
a person who exercises control over workers; if you want to leave early you have to ask the foreman / a man who is foreperson of a jury / The first or chief man / a worker, especially a man, who supervises and directs other workers., | |
Usage | ⇒ If you want to leave early you have to ask the foreman ⇒ For management officials and industrial arbitrators, male aggression towards foremen and supervisors was far more serious than such behavior toward fellow workers. ⇒ The foreman of a jury |
Synonyms | boss, chief, supervisor, manager, overseer, superintendent, head, director, gaffer, administrator, executive, honcho, straw boss, leader, forewoman, headman, taskmaster, governor, master, captain, |
